Google has recently announced that it will be raising its minimum quality requirements for Android apps available on the Play Store. The company’s latest spam policy update dictates that apps with “limited functionality and content” will no longer be permitted on the platform, effective August 31st. A widespread issue is currently impacting thousands of Windows machines across various industries worldwide. The problem stems from a faulty update released by cybersecurity provider CrowdStrike, which has sent affected PCs and servers into a recovery boot loop, rendering them unable to start properly. Figma, a popular design tool company, recently faced a controversy when its AI design tool, “Make Designs,” was accused of generating designs that closely resembled Apple’s weather app. This raised concerns about potential legal implications for users who unknowingly used the tool to create similar designs. A recent cyberattack on Disney resulted in the leaked of over a terabyte of data from the company’s internal messaging channels. This breach, orchestrated by a self-proclaimed hacktivist group known as Nullbulge, has caused a ripple effect in the digital world. In a recent lawsuit filed by powerful record labels such as UMG Recordings, Warner Music, and Sony Music, Verizon has been accused of intentionally turning a blind eye to its customers’ copyright violations for profit. Apple is set to introduce a new feature in its upcoming major updates for iOS, iPadOS, and macOS. The new “Recovered” album in the Photos app is designed to assist users in locating photos and videos that may have been lost or damaged on their devices.
